Abstract
A reconfigurable antenna built on E-shaped structure with an ability to control bandwidth is discussed in this proposed work. To configure antenna automatic or manual tuning is done so that they can accustom to the varying system requirements thus can avoid those limitation and offers extra functionality. A frequency reconfigurable E-shaped patch antenna can be utilized for improving the bandwidth. The bandwidth can cover the frequency range from 1.85 GHz-2.33 GHz. The enactments of the offered antenna, in terms of reflection losses and radiation patterns, with divergent DC bias voltages is analyzed using a varactor diode. A broad research was taken over to analyze the nature of the antenna at different frequency.
